101// prepareInstanceCopies prepares a list of instances which needs to copied to the manifest list.
102func prepareInstanceCopies(list internalManifest.List, instanceDigests []digest.Digest, options *Options) ([]instanceCopy, error) {
103 res := []instanceCopy{}
104 if options.ImageListSelection == CopySpecificImages && len(options.EnsureCompressionVariantsExist) > 0 {
105 // List can already contain compressed instance for a compression selected in `EnsureCompressionVariantsExist`
106 // It’s unclear what it means when `CopySpecificImages` includes an instance in options.Instances,
107 // EnsureCompressionVariantsExist asks for an instance with some compression,
108 // an instance with that compression already exists, but is not included in options.Instances.
109 // We might define the semantics and implement this in the future.
110 return res, fmt.Errorf("EnsureCompressionVariantsExist is not implemented for CopySpecificImages")
111 }
112 err := validateCompressionVariantExists(options.EnsureCompressionVariantsExist)
113 if err != nil {
114 return res, err
115 }
116 compressionsByPlatform, err := platformCompressionMap(list, instanceDigests)
117 if err != nil {
118 return nil, err
119 }
120 for i, instanceDigest := range instanceDigests {
121 if options.ImageListSelection == CopySpecificImages &&
122 !slices.Contains(options.Instances, instanceDigest) {
123 logrus.Debugf("Skipping instance %s (%d/%d)", instanceDigest, i+1, len(instanceDigests))
124 continue
125 }
126 instanceDetails, err := list.Instance(instanceDigest)
127 if err != nil {
128 return res, fmt.Errorf("getting details for instance %s: %w", instanceDigest, err)
129 }
130 forceCompressionFormat, err := shouldRequireCompressionFormatMatch(options)
131 if err != nil {
132 return nil, err
133 }
134 res = append(res, instanceCopy{
135 op: instanceCopyCopy,
136 sourceDigest: instanceDigest,
137 copyForceCompressionFormat: forceCompressionFormat,
138 })
139 platform := platformV1ToPlatformComparable(instanceDetails.ReadOnly.Platform)
140 compressionList := compressionsByPlatform[platform]
141 for _, compressionVariant := range options.EnsureCompressionVariantsExist {
142 if !compressionList.Contains(compressionVariant.Algorithm.Name()) {
143 res = append(res, instanceCopy{
144 op: instanceCopyClone,
145 sourceDigest: instanceDigest,
146 cloneArtifactType: instanceDetails.ReadOnly.ArtifactType,
147 cloneCompressionVariant: compressionVariant,
148 clonePlatform: instanceDetails.ReadOnly.Platform,
149 cloneAnnotations: maps.Clone(instanceDetails.ReadOnly.Annotations),
150 })
151 // add current compression to the list so that we don’t create duplicate clones
152 compressionList.Add(compressionVariant.Algorithm.Name())
153 }
154 }
155 }
156 return res, nil
157}
